Super Wash is listed under Auto Washing & Polishing and is located at San Diego, California.
Business Description :
Address : 1460 S 43rd St, Ste D San Diego, CA 92113-4545
City : San Diego
Pin Code : 92113
Phone : (619) 262-0686
E-mail :
Website :
Service Area Category : Auto Washing & Polishing in San Diego - 92113
Category : Auto Washing & Polishing in San Diego
Services : Auto Washing & Polishing